Maintenance and Troubleshooting Tips for Optimal Performance

Regular maintenance of your coffee serving robot is required for efficient performance. This involves constant cleaning. Coffee residue and oils can build up inside the machine; therefore, it is important to clean the outside and the inside accessible parts using a soft cloth or brush. Pay special attention to the dispensing mechanism and check for clogs that may impede coffee flow. It is important to regularly check and replace water filters, contributing to the taste of coffee served.

Troubleshooting common mishaps is vital to ensure the robot is running well. If the machine is not brewing, check for power supply and water levels first. A soft reset helps with most minor software glitches, and do not hesitate to turn the machine off and on. If the robot is not dispensing coffee properly, look for any blockages on the nozzle and clean it properly. Also, check your user manual for the error codes, which can be a quick fix for complex matters.

Finally, maintaining the robot's firmware is just as important as the hardware. Regular firmware updates will not only add functionality but also enhance safety features. Periodically check for software updates from the manufacturers' website or app. By adhering to these maintenance and troubleshooting suggestions, you will be able to maintain the reliability of your coffee-serving robot and guarantee perfect brews each time.
